Black Friday deals aren’t limited to physical goods. You can find discounts on everything from fitness trackers to Kindles , but subscriptions also get discounts on Black Friday. For example, Apple TV is no longer Apple TV+ , mind you. Apple’s subscription is typically relatively expensive at $12.99 per month. But starting today, November 21st, new and existing Apple TV customers can sign up for a six-month Apple TV subscription for $5.99 per month. That’s over 50% off each month (53.89%, to be exact).

You have time to take advantage of the discount. After all, it’s a Black Friday deal, so you can subscribe now, until 8:00 PM PT on December 1st (Cyber ​​Monday). After that, your subscription will last for six months, but keep an eye on your calendar: after those six months, Apple will charge you the full price of $12.99 again. You’ll also need to subscribe using a method that allows Apple to bill you directly. You won’t be able to take advantage of the discount if you subscribe to Apple TV through a third-party provider. Finally, you won’t be able to take advantage of the discount if your account qualifies for a free trial.

If you’re not yet an Apple TV user, now is the time to give it a try. The platform offers a surprisingly large catalog , including popular series like Severance , Ted Lasso , and Shrinking . New episodes of several other series are also currently being released, including Pluribus , The Morning Show, and The Last Frontier .

You can redeem the offer from any device that bills directly to Apple, or on the official Apple TV website .

Are Cyber ​​Monday deals better than Black Friday?

Black Friday used to favor large retailers and higher-end appliances, while Cyber ​​Monday favored cheaper appliances and gave small businesses a chance to compete online. However, today, this distinction has become virtually meaningless. Every major retailer runs sales on both days, so it’s best to know what you need, use price trackers, or consult guides like our blog , which uses price trackers, and not worry about finding the perfect time.
